Bio
Siska is a trained psycholinguist and obtained her PhD in 2006 with a dissertation about simultaneous second language acquisition in youngsters. Since 2011, she has worked at the Karel de Grote University of Applies Sciences and Arts as a practice-based researcher in the Research Centre Pedagogy in Practice and as a lecturer in the Early Childhood Education program. Since 2023, Siska has chaired the Belgian committee of the NGO OMEP. At the research center, she combines action research, experiential research with children, and design research in national and international collaborations. She immersed herself in the topics: pedagogical documentation as a research method, children in reception centres, migration, children's rights, intercultural dynamics, sustainability and language stimulation.
